About The Position

The Site Supervisor - Physical Therapist role at Orthopedic Associates of Hartford (OAH), in partnership with Hartford HealthCare, is responsible for delivering high-quality, cost-effective physical therapy services within an outpatient setting. This integrated model provides direct access to orthopedic surgeons and a team-centered approach to patient care. The position involves approximately 80% direct patient care and 20% administrative time, focusing on managing site resources (human, material, and financial) to ensure optimal patient outcomes and compliance with organizational standards.
